Sounds to me like the tune is way out of wack. The WOT tuning needs to be done with a wideband, if not then its a guessing game as to what your AFR will be.
Even though they are not accurate at all at WOT what mv are your O2s reading at WOT?
Can you post your tune or a logged run?

Woah that IDC is high! I didnt get to look over the whole tune because its on my laptop and i am at work right now and my battery died on me but i didnt really see anything that really jumped out at me yet in the tune itself.
You havent touched the injector table at all correct? The one thing that I do like to do in the PE enable is set all the map values etc... to all 0s to ensure that you dont have any kind of delay at all in PE but other than that and like i said i didnt get a chance to see everything.
I wonder if their is maybe something wrong with the regulator? Have you checked to make sure you dont have any vaccum leaks anywhere?
